SAMSHA Press ReleaseJune 25, 2009 The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) issued a press release on June 18, 2009, reporting on results of a new study that revealed a father's alcohol use may significantly affect their adolescent's use of alcohol and drugs. Analyses of 2002 through 2007 data drawn from the National Survey on Drug Use and Health, involving responses from 11,056 fathers and 9,537 father-child respondent pairs served as the basis of this study. CAFY's SAFE HOMES Program is a support network for Acton-Boxborough parents who are concerned about alcohol and drug use at pre-teen and teen parties and gatherings. Families who join SAFE HOMES promise to provide a safe and supervised home for teen parties.
